These are baked turkey meatballs seasoned with oregano, cumin, dill, thyme, cinnamon, and nutmeg, with crumbled feta and fresh parsley and mint mixed right into the meat. The honest reason to make them: 30 minutes start to finish, one bowl, one pan, and the spice list sounds long but it’s all dry pantry staples you likely already have.

Why this recipe works

Two things actually matter here. First, the feta does double duty — it seasons the mix from the inside and adds enough fat and moisture to keep 93% lean turkey from drying out in a hot oven. Second, coconut flour absorbs liquid differently than breadcrumbs: it soaks up the egg and any moisture released by the turkey, which tightens the mixture just enough to hold a ball without making the texture dense. The result is a meatball that stays together on the pan and stays tender when you bite into it.

If something goes sideways

  • Mix is too wet to roll: Coconut flour varies by brand and humidity. Add another half teaspoon at a time, up to an extra full tablespoon, and let the mix sit for two minutes — it keeps absorbing. Don’t swap in regular flour at a 1:1 ratio; it won’t behave the same way.
  • Meatballs flatten on the pan: The mix was probably overworked or too warm. Chill the shaped meatballs in the fridge for 10 minutes before baking. Cold fat holds its shape better in the first minutes of heat.
  • No fresh herbs on hand: Dried parsley and dried mint work fine. Use one teaspoon dried for every tablespoon fresh called for. Skip the garnish — not worth the extra dish.
  • No feta in the house: A firm goat cheese crumbled in is the closest substitute. Ricotta is too wet and will throw off the texture. If you have neither, add an extra pinch of salt and a teaspoon of olive oil to compensate for the missing fat and seasoning.
  • Meatballs read under 165°F at 13 minutes: Oven calibration varies. Give them another 2–3 minutes and check again. Do not pull them early — ground turkey must reach 165°F (74°C) all the way through.

Storage and reheating

Cooked meatballs keep in a sealed container in the fridge for up to 4 days. For freezing, spread them on a sheet pan until solid, then transfer to a freezer bag — they’ll keep for 3 months without sticking together. Reheat from frozen in a 350°F oven for 12–15 minutes, or from fridge-cold in a covered skillet with a splash of water over medium-low heat for about 5 minutes. The microwave works too but tends to toughen the outside; if that’s your only option, use 50% power in 30-second bursts.

Prep Time 15 minutes mins
Cook Time 15 minutes mins
Total Time 30 minutes mins
Course Main Course
Cuisine Greek
Servings 4 people
Calories 204 kcal

Ingredients
 
 

  • Turkey Mince1 pound ground turkey (minced turkey) - 93% lean
  • Feta Cheese Cubes On White2 ounces feta cheese - full-fat
  • Chicken Egg1 large egg - whisked
  • Parsley On White Background3 tablespoons parsley - fresh, minced
  • Bowl Of Coconut Flour2 tablespoons coconut flour
  • Fresh Mint Leaves1 tablespoon mint - fresh, minced
  • Dried Garlic½ teaspoon garlic powder
  •  
    ½ teaspoon ground basil
  •  
    ½ teaspoon ground oregano
  • Ground Cumin¾ teaspoon cumin
  •  
    ¾ teaspoon ground dill
  •  
    ¾ teaspoon ground thyme
  • Wooden Bowl Of Salt½ teaspoon salt
  • Heap Of Ground Nutmeg And Whole Nutmeg Seeds¼ teaspoon ground nutmeg
  •  
    ¼ teaspoon cinnamon powder

Instructions
 

  • Preheat your oven to 400°F and line the rimmed ba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• Combine all of the ingredients in a big bowl and mix properly. Use a cookie scoop or spoon about 1 tablespoon-sized, and put onto the pan, rolling them into a ball. This recipe can make about 20 meatballs.
  • Bake for about 10-13 minutes or until the thermometer inserted in the middle of the meatballs reads 165°F.
  • Serve and Enjoy!

Common questions

Can I use ground chicken instead of ground turkey?

Yes, ground chicken works as a direct swap. Stick with 93% lean if you can find it — extra-lean ground chicken has even less fat than turkey and will dry out faster, so watch the oven time and pull them as soon as they hit 165°F (74°C).

Can I substitute regular breadcrumbs for the coconut flour?

You can use plain breadcrumbs, but the ratio is different — use 3 tablespoons of breadcrumbs in place of the 2 tablespoons of coconut flour, since coconut flour absorbs much more liquid. The meatballs will no longer be gluten-free or low-carb, but the texture will still be good.

Do I have to use all those spices, or can I simplify?

The core flavor comes from oregano, cumin, and garlic powder — if you’re missing a couple of the others, the meatballs will still taste distinctly seasoned. The cinnamon and nutmeg are small amounts but they add a background warmth that makes these taste different from a generic herb meatball, so keep those if you have them.
